Job Description
COMMUNICATIONS SPECIALIST
University of Alabama at Birmingham
The Communications Specialist is responsible for managing the development and implementation of content for the National Center on Health, Physical Activity and Disability (NCHPAD). They will work under the direction of the Medical Editor to support media production staff, oversee content planning, production, and distribution across multiple platforms. The position will collaborate with program teams, creative staff, and leadership to support communication goals and ensure high-quality, accessible resources are delivered.
Key Roles & Responsibilities
* Supports unit-wide communications initiatives by gathering information, preparing materials, and coordinating distribution using university approved platforms and tools.
* Drafts, edits, and produces content for channels that may include web, email, social media, video, newsletters, and print publications.
* Tracks and reports on engagement metrics to evaluate communications effectiveness.
* Provides logistical and administrative support for communication projects and initiatives.
* Collaborates with colleagues and stakeholders to implement communications projects and initiatives.
* Perform other duties as assigned.
QualificationsQualifications
Bachelor's degree in Communications, English, Journalism, Marketing, Public Relations, or a related field. Work experience may NOT substitute for the education requirement.
Knowledge, Skills, Abilities & Work Characteristics
* Knowledge and understanding of advanced video equipment, lighting techniques and audio techniques
* Strong written and verbal communication skills
* Ability to work independently and collaboratively
* Ability to multi-task and prioritize effectively
* Ability to work independently and collaborate
* Proficient with productivity, communication and marketing tools and software
